46 /*
47 * The TWL4030 "Triton 2" is one of a family of a multi-function "Power
48 * Management and System Companion Device" chips originally designed for
49 * use in OMAP2 and OMAP 3 based systems. Its control interfaces use I2C,
50 * often at around 3 Mbit/sec, including for interrupt handling.
51 *
52 * This driver core provides genirq support for the interrupts emitted,
53 * by the various modules, and exports register access primitives.
54 *
55 * FIXME this driver currently requires use of the first interrupt line
56 * (and associated registers).
57 */

338 /* Exported Functions */
339
340 /**
341 * twl_i2c_write - Writes a n bit register in TWL4030/TWL5030/TWL60X0
342 * @mod_no: module number
343 * @value: an array of num_bytes+1 containing data to write
344 * @reg: register address (just offset will do)
345 * @num_bytes: number of bytes to transfer
346 *
347 * IMPORTANT: for 'value' parameter: Allocate value num_bytes+1 and
348 * valid data starts at Offset 1.
349 *
350 * Returns the result of operation - 0 is success
351 */
352 int twl_i2c_write(u8 mod_no, u8 *value, u8 reg, unsigned num_bytes)
353 {
354 int ret;
355 int sid;
356 struct twl_client *twl;
357 struct i2c_msg *msg;
358
359 if (unlikely(mod_no > TWL_MODULE_LAST)) {
360 pr_err("%s: invalid module number %d\n", DRIVER_NAME, mod_no);
361 return -EPERM;
362 }
363 sid = twl_map[mod_no].sid;
364 twl = &twl_modules[sid];
365
366 if (unlikely(!inuse)) {
367 pr_err("%s: client %d is not initialized\n", DRIVER_NAME, sid);
368 return -EPERM;
369 }
370 mutex_lock(&twl->xfer_lock);
371 /*
372 * [MSG1]: fill the register address data
373 * fill the data Tx buffer
374 */
375 msg = &twl->xfer_msg[0];
376 msg->addr = twl->address;
377 msg->len = num_bytes + 1;
378 msg->flags = 0;
379 msg->buf = value;
380 /* over write the first byte of buffer with the register address */
381 *value = twl_map[mod_no].base + reg;
382 ret = i2c_transfer(twl->client->adapter, twl->xfer_msg, 1);
383 mutex_unlock(&twl->xfer_lock);
384
385 /* i2c_transfer returns number of messages transferred */
386 if (ret != 1) {
387 pr_err("%s: i2c_write failed to transfer all messages\n",
388 DRIVER_NAME);
389 if (ret < 0)
390 return ret;
391 else
392 return -EIO;
393 } else {
394 return 0;
395 }
396 }

398
399 /**
400 * twl_i2c_read - Reads a n bit register in TWL4030/TWL5030/TWL60X0
401 * @mod_no: module number
402 * @value: an array of num_bytes containing data to be read
403 * @reg: register address (just offset will do)
404 * @num_bytes: number of bytes to transfer
405 *
406 * Returns result of operation - num_bytes is success else failure.
407 */
408 int twl_i2c_read(u8 mod_no, u8 *value, u8 reg, unsigned num_bytes)
409 {
410 int ret;
411 u8 val;
412 int sid;
413 struct twl_client *twl;
414 struct i2c_msg *msg;
415
416 if (unlikely(mod_no > TWL_MODULE_LAST)) {
417 pr_err("%s: invalid module number %d\n", DRIVER_NAME, mod_no);
418 return -EPERM;
419 }
420 sid = twl_map[mod_no].sid;
421 twl = &twl_modules[sid];
422
423 if (unlikely(!inuse)) {
424 pr_err("%s: client %d is not initialized\n", DRIVER_NAME, sid);
425 return -EPERM;
426 }
427 mutex_lock(&twl->xfer_lock);
428 /* [MSG1] fill the register address data */
429 msg = &twl->xfer_msg[0];
430 msg->addr = twl->address;
431 msg->len = 1;
432 msg->flags = 0; /* Read the register value */
433 val = twl_map[mod_no].base + reg;
434 msg->buf = &val;
435 /* [MSG2] fill the data rx buffer */
436 msg = &twl->xfer_msg[1];
437 msg->addr = twl->address;
438 msg->flags = I2C_M_RD; /* Read the register value */
439 msg->len = num_bytes; /* only n bytes */
440 msg->buf = value;
441 ret = i2c_transfer(twl->client->adapter, twl->xfer_msg, 2);
442 mutex_unlock(&twl->xfer_lock);
443
444 /* i2c_transfer returns number of messages transferred */
445 if (ret != 2) {
446 pr_err("%s: i2c_read failed to transfer all messages\n",
447 DRIVER_NAME);
448 if (ret < 0)
449 return ret;
450 else
451 return -EIO;
452 } else {
453 return 0;
454 }
455 }
456 EXPORT_SYMBOL(twl_i2c_read);

942 /*----------------------------------------------------------------------*/
943
944 /*
945 * These three functions initialize the on-chip clock framework,
946 * letting it generate the right frequencies for USB, MADC, and
947 * other purposes.
948 */
949 static inline int __init protect_pm_master(void)
950 {
951 int e = 0;
952
953 e = twl_i2c_write_u8(TWL4030_MODULE_PM_MASTER, 0,
954 TWL4030_PM_MASTER_PROTECT_KEY);
955 return e;
956 }
957
958 static inline int __init unprotect_pm_master(void)
959 {
960 int e = 0;
961
962 e |= twl_i2c_write_u8(TWL4030_MODULE_PM_MASTER,
963 TWL4030_PM_MASTER_KEY_CFG1,
964 TWL4030_PM_MASTER_PROTECT_KEY);
965 e |= twl_i2c_write_u8(TWL4030_MODULE_PM_MASTER,
966 TWL4030_PM_MASTER_KEY_CFG2,
967 TWL4030_PM_MASTER_PROTECT_KEY);
968
969 return e;
970 }
971
972 static void clocks_init(struct device *dev,
973 struct twl4030_clock_init_data *clock)
974 {
975 int e = 0;
976 struct clk *osc;
977 u32 rate;
978 u8 ctrl = HFCLK_FREQ_26_MHZ;
979
980 #if defined(CONFIG_ARCH_OMAP2) || defined(CONFIG_ARCH_OMAP3)
981 if (cpu_is_omap2430())
982 osc = clk_get(dev, "osc_ck");
983 else
984 osc = clk_get(dev, "osc_sys_ck");
985
986 if (IS_ERR(osc)) {
987 printk(KERN_WARNING "Skipping twl internal clock init and "
988 "using bootloader value (unknown osc rate)\n");
989 return;
990 }
991
992 rate = clk_get_rate(osc);
993 clk_put(osc);
994
995 #else
996 /* REVISIT for non-OMAP systems, pass the clock rate from
997 * board init code, using platform_data.
998 */
999 osc = ERR_PTR(-EIO);
1000
1001 printk(KERN_WARNING "Skipping twl internal clock init and "
1002 "using bootloader value (unknown osc rate)\n");
1003
1004 return;
1005 #endif
1006
1007 switch (rate) {
1008 case 19200000:
1009 ctrl = HFCLK_FREQ_19p2_MHZ;
1010 break;
1011 case 26000000:
1012 ctrl = HFCLK_FREQ_26_MHZ;
1013 break;
1014 case 38400000:
1015 ctrl = HFCLK_FREQ_38p4_MHZ;
1016 break;
1017 }
1018
1019 ctrl |= HIGH_PERF_SQ;
1020 if (clock && clock->ck32k_lowpwr_enable)
1021 ctrl |= CK32K_LOWPWR_EN;
1022
1023 e |= unprotect_pm_master();
1024 /* effect->MADC+USB ck en */
1025 e |= twl_i2c_write_u8(TWL_MODULE_PM_MASTER, ctrl, R_CFG_BOOT);
1026 e |= protect_pm_master();
1027
1028 if (e < 0)
1029 pr_err("%s: clock init err [%d]\n", DRIVER_NAME, e);
1030 }

1164
1165 static const struct i2c_device_id twl_ids[] = {
1166 { "twl4030", TWL4030_VAUX2 }, /* "Triton 2" */
1167 { "twl5030", 0 }, /* T2 updated */
1168 { "twl5031", TWL5031 }, /* TWL5030 updated */
1169 { "tps65950", 0 }, /* catalog version of twl5030 */
1170 { "tps65930", TPS_SUBSET }, /* fewer LDOs and DACs; no charger */
1171 { "tps65920", TPS_SUBSET }, /* fewer LDOs; no codec or charger */
1172 { "twl6030", TWL6030_CLASS }, /* "Phoenix power chip" */
1173 { /* end of list */ },
1174 };
